Bumble Boost and Bumble Premium solve different problems. Boost is the cheaper control tier: more swipes, more time, undo swipes, rematches, Spotlight, and SuperSwipes. Premium is the efficiency tier: it includes Boost, then adds Liked You/Beeline, advanced filters, Incognito Mode, and Travel Mode.

So the best choice is not "which one has more features?" Premium has more. The useful question is: which feature fixes the bottleneck you actually have on Bumble?

Quick answer: Bumble Boost vs Premium

Choose Bumble Boost if your problem is timing or swipe control:

  • You run out of swipes.
  • You accidentally swipe left and want Backtrack.
  • Matches expire before anyone starts the conversation.
  • You want one weekly Spotlight and five weekly SuperSwipes.
  • You do not need to see your Beeline.

Choose Bumble Premium if your problem is filtering, privacy, travel, or time:

  • You want to see who already liked you.
  • You want more advanced filters.
  • You want Incognito Mode.
  • You want Travel Mode.
  • You already get some likes and want to convert them faster.

Choose neither if your profile is not getting likes. In that case, the fix is usually better photos, sharper prompts, and better opening messages before any subscription.

Official feature comparison

Bumble's support page lists the current paid tiers and what each one includes. According to Bumble, Boost includes Backtrack, time extensions on current matches, unlimited swipes, one Spotlight per week, and five SuperSwipes per week.

Bumble Premium includes those Boost features and adds:

  • Unlimited Advanced Filters
  • Liked You / Beeline access
  • Travel Mode
  • Rematch with expired users
  • Incognito Mode

Bumble Premium+ adds more weekly extras and visibility tools. Bumble lists Profile Insights, two Spotlights per week, ten SuperSwipes per week, and two Compliments per week among the Premium+ features.

What Bumble Boost is best for

Boost is best when the free version feels slightly too limited but you do not need the full Premium toolkit.

You miss the 24-hour window

Bumble matches can expire if the conversation does not start in time. Boost gives you more flexibility through extends and rematches. That helps if you are busy, travel during the week, or do not check the app daily.

You swipe fast and make mistakes

Backtrack is useful if you often reject someone by accident. This is a convenience feature, not a match-quality feature, but it removes a common frustration.

You want occasional visibility without Premium

Bumble's own Boost explainer says the plan includes one weekly Spotlight and five weekly SuperSwipes. That can be useful if your profile is already decent and you want a small visibility push.

You do not care about Beeline

If you are comfortable swiping normally and do not need to see everyone who liked you, Boost may cover enough. Premium's biggest extra is Liked You/Beeline, so do not pay for it unless that would change how you use the app.

What Bumble Premium is best for

Premium is best when time, privacy, or filtering matter more than the basic Boost tools.

You want to see who liked you

Liked You/Beeline is the main reason to choose Premium over Boost. Instead of swiping through the main stack and waiting for matches, you can review people who have already shown interest.

This is most useful when your Beeline has enough people in it. If the Beeline is mostly empty, Premium loses a lot of value.

You want advanced filters

Premium's advanced filters help if you have real dealbreakers. Use them for practical fit, not fantasy shopping. Too many filters can make the app feel empty, especially outside large cities.

You want Incognito Mode

Incognito Mode is a strong Premium use case. It lets you stay hidden from the general stack and appear only to people you have liked first. That is useful if you date in a small professional circle, work in a public role, or simply want more control over visibility.

You want Travel Mode

Travel Mode is useful if you are moving, visiting another city, or dating across locations. It lets you set your location before you arrive, which can make travel dates easier to plan.

How much do Boost and Premium cost?

Bumble does not give one universal public price for every account. Its pricing support page says the cost of Premium, Premium+, Boost, and add-ons may vary by tier, duration, and package size.

Before you buy, open Bumble and check the current Pay Plan screen. Confirm:

  • The tier: Boost, Premium, or Premium+
  • The duration: weekly, monthly, multi-month, or lifetime if offered
  • The renewal terms
  • The included features
  • Any promotion or trial terms

A static price from an old review can be wrong for your account, country, device, or current offer.

Which tier gives better value?

Boost gives better value when your needs are simple. If you only want Backtrack, extends, rematches, unlimited swipes, SuperSwipes, and Spotlight, Premium is more than you need.

Premium gives better value when Beeline, Incognito, Travel Mode, or advanced filters would change your daily behavior. If you would use those tools every week, Premium can save more time than Boost.

Premium+ only makes sense if the extra visibility tools are worth the jump for you. If your profile is already converting and you are in a dense market, the extra Spotlights, SuperSwipes, Compliments, and Profile Insights may be useful. If your profile is weak, Premium+ is usually the wrong first move.

A decision framework before paying

Use this quick check:

  1. Are you getting likes on free Bumble? If no, improve the profile first.
  2. Are matches expiring because of timing? If yes, consider Boost.
  3. Do you want to see who already liked you? If yes, consider Premium.
  4. Do you need privacy or travel controls? If yes, Premium is the better fit.
  5. Do you only want more people to like you? Fix photos and prompts before paying.

Paid features can help you manage Bumble more efficiently. They cannot replace a profile that gives people a clear reason to swipe right.

Bumble Premium vs Boost FAQ

Is Bumble Boost the same as Bumble Premium?

No. Boost is the lower paid tier. Premium includes Boost features and adds Liked You/Beeline, advanced filters, Incognito Mode, and Travel Mode.

Does Bumble Premium include Bumble Boost?

Yes. Bumble lists Premium as including Boost features plus additional Premium tools.

Is Bumble Boost worth it?

Boost can be worth it if you use Bumble actively and your main pain points are swipes, expired matches, accidental left swipes, Spotlight, or SuperSwipes. It is less useful if you want Beeline, privacy, travel, or deeper filtering.

Is Bumble Premium worth it?

Premium can be worth it if you already get likes and want to save time with Beeline, filter more carefully, browse privately, or date in another city. It is less useful if your profile is not attracting likes yet.

Is Bumble Premium better for guys?

It depends on the profile. For men who already get some likes, Beeline can make matching more efficient. For men getting no likes, Premium usually makes the weak profile problem more visible.

Can I cancel after testing one tier?

Yes, but cancellation depends on how you subscribed. Bumble's support page explains that subscriptions are canceled through Apple, Google Play, Bumble in-app settings, or Bumble web depending on the original payment method. Paid benefits remain active until the end of the subscription period.
